F1: Represents restricted stock granted upon stockholder approval of an amendment to the Company's 2010 Long-Term Incentive Plan to increase the number of shares available under that plan, which occurred on June 7, 2011. The restrictions expire on December 31, 2012 so long as the reporting person is then employed by the Issuer or any of its subsidiaries.

F2: Each IFMI, LLC (formerly Cohen Brothers, LLC) membership unit is redeemable at the reporting person's option, at any time on or after January 1, 2013, for (i) cash in an amount equal to the average of the per share closing prices of the Company common stock for the ten consecutive trading days immediately preceding the date the Company receives the reporting person's notice of redemption, or (ii) at the Company's option, one share of the Company's common stock (up to an aggregate of 4,983,556 of such shares if all of the membership units are redeemed for shares), subject, in each case, to appropriate adjustment upon the occurrence of an issuance of additional shares of the Company's common stock as a dividend or other distribution on the Company's outstanding common stock, or a further subdivision or combination of the outstanding shares of the Company's common stock.
